Installation fees for business WiFi support packages can vary widely. Charges range from R997 to R9,543.85, depending on setup complexity. Promotional offers can significantly reduce these costs.
New Pure Fibre signups can save up to R5,000 on installation fees. This makes affordable business WiFi support packages more accessible.
Provider | Installation Fee |
---|---|
TT Connect | R1,497.00 |
Clear Access | R1,725.00 |
Vodacom | R1,497.00 |
Waterfall Access Networks | R9,543.85 |

Comparing WiFi Maintenance Providers in South Africa – WiFi Maintenance Package Prices
South Africa’s WiFi market offers a variety of support service packages. We’ve analysed top providers to help you find the best option. Monthly plans range from R289 to R1,145, catering to different needs and budgets.
Zoom Fibre provides the most affordable plan at R289 monthly. Cool Ideas offers premium services at R1,145 per month. Speed offerings vary greatly, from Clear Access’s 8 Mbps to Cool Ideas’ 100 Mbps.
ITNT and Vodacom offer 25 Mbps plans at R425 and R499 respectively. Openserve stands out with its 20 Mbps plan at just R299, providing excellent value for speed.
Most providers offer high reliability for home and business WiFi service contracts. WIRUlink has built a strong reputation for outstanding customer service.
Provider | Speed (Mbps) | Monthly Price | Reliability Rating |
---|---|---|---|
Zoom Fibre | 10 | R289 | High |
Openserve | 20 | R299 | High |
ITNT | 25 | R425 | High |
Vodacom | 25 | R499 | High |
Cool Ideas | 100 | R1,145 | High |

5. How do WiFi maintenance costs differ between major cities like Johannesburg and smaller towns in South Africa?
WiFi maintenance costs in major cities like Johannesburg tend to be 10% to 20% higher. This is due to increased operational costs and competition for skilled technicians. However, the difference is usually not substantial.
6. What factors can affect the cost of a WiFi maintenance package?
Several factors influence WiFi maintenance package costs. These include network size and complexity, support level, and guaranteed response time. Other factors are on-site support inclusion and additional services like security monitoring or performance optimisation.
